RESOLUTION NO. 90-07
BEING A RESOLUTION ESTABLISHING REFUSE, YARD WASTE, AND RECYCLING SERVICE
RATES
WHEREAS, Ordinance No. 853, City Code of 1977 (as amended), pertaining to Garbage
and Rubbish Service provides for the setting of appropriate rates for the services
rendered, and
WHEREAS, the City awarded a two-year contract to Waste Management-Blaine, to pro-
vide refuse collection service in the City of Columbia Heights, and
WHEREAS, the contract allows for a rate adjustment in the second year based on
increases in landfill fees, and
WHEREAS, based on an increase in landfill fees such rates have been adjusted;
N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ED that the following monthly Refuse Service Rates
be adopted and put into effect as of January 1, 1990, on all billings rendered
thereafter.
*RESIDENTIAL SERVICE
Private Residences - One Pickup Per Week
(and per unit in additional dwelling units of two
and three family buildings) with one pickup per week
$15.70
Senior Citizens - One Pickup Per Week
as defined by Council Resolution establishing eligibility
$11.79
*Any additional yard waste disposal costs incurred by the City
will be passed d~rectly onto the residents. Sales taxes on-muni-
cipal solid waste, currently 6%, will be added to the above rates.

Councilmember Nawrocki requested that the City Manager draft a short notice to
be inserted into the utility bills explaining the rate increase. He felt it
should be noted on the notice that this was done at the request of the Mayor
and the City Council.
